Subscriptions are configuration points defined in the Yang model for which confdmgr wants to be notified
when a change occurs.
clear confdmgr confd cdb
This Exec mode command erases the configuration in the ConfD Configuration Database (CDB) which is
used by ConfD to store configuration objects. StarOS accesses the database via ConfD-supplied APIs.
The CDB cannot be erased unless the Context Configuration mode no server confd command is run in
Note
the local context to disable ConfD and NETCONF protocol support.

Clearing the CDB is a terminal operation. The CDB will be repopulated when the Context Configuration
Caution
mode server confd command is run in the local context to re-enable ConfD and NETCONF protocol
support.
